Analysis
The most recent figure for arms imports (sipri trend indicator values), per unit of gdp in Bulgaria is 0 SIPRI trend indicator values per US$ of GDP, measured in 2022.
That represents a change of up 179.7% on the previous year and down 64.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, arms imports (sipri trend indicator values), per unit of gdp in Bulgaria peaked at 0.0543 SIPRI trend indicator values per US$ of GDP in 1984 and was at its lowest, 0 SIPRI trend indicator values per US$ of GDP, in 2021.
Bulgaria ranks 157th of 169 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Arms imports (SIPRI trend indicator values)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Arms imports (SIPRI trend indicator values) ÷ GDP (current US$)
Computed from
- Arms imports Arms Transfers Programme, Stockholm International Peace Research Institute (SIPRI)
- GDP Country official statistics, National Statistical Organizations and/or Central Banks
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
